Remission-induction regimens in acute nonlymphocytic leukemia
The Western Journal of Medicine
|October 1, 1980
Summary
Adding daunomycin (DNM) to cytarabine (Ara-C) and 6-thioguanine (6-TG) for acute nonlymphocytic leukemia (ANLL) improved remission rates but not survival. This ANLL treatment strategy requires further investigation for improved patient outcomes.

Background:
- Acute nonlymphocytic leukemia (ANLL) is a significant hematologic malignancy.
- Current treatment regimens for ANLL aim to improve remission rates and patient survival.
- The efficacy of daunomycin (DNM) in combination therapy for ANLL requires further evaluation.
Purpose of the Study:
- To compare the efficacy of cytarabine (Ara-C) and 6-thioguanine (6-TG) versus Ara-C, 6-TG, and daunomycin (DNM) in treating adult ANLL.
- To assess the impact of DNM addition on complete remission (CR) rates and overall survival.
- To review existing literature on DNM-based regimens for adult ANLL.
Main Methods:
- A sequential study involving 40 adult ANLL patients.
- Group 1 (n=20): Treated with Ara-C and 6-TG.
- Group 2 (n=20): Treated with Ara-C, 6-TG, and a three-day course of DNM.
Main Results:
- The DNM-treated group exhibited a higher CR rate compared to the control group.
- Despite higher CR rates, the DNM-treated group did not demonstrate significantly improved overall survival.
- Literature review corroborated findings of higher CR but not significantly better survival with DNM-combined regimens.
Conclusions:
- Daunomycin is an active agent in ANLL treatment, contributing to higher remission rates.
- The addition of DNM to initial Ara-C and 6-TG therapy does not significantly improve overall survival in adult ANLL patients.
- Further research is needed to optimize DNM's role in ANLL treatment protocols to enhance patient survival.
